How to change your email address on Binance? (Profile Update)

To change your Binance email, log in, go to Security > Email > Edit, verify identity via 2FA/KYC, enter a valid new email, confirm with a 6-digit code sent there, and complete verification—old inbox access is mandatory.

Accessing Your Binance Account Settings

1. Log in to your Binance account using your current credentials, including your registered email and password.

2. Navigate to the top-right corner of the Binance homepage and click on your profile icon.

3. From the dropdown menu, select Security to enter the security management interface.

4. Ensure two-factor authentication is active before proceeding—Binance requires 2FA for email modification as a mandatory security layer.

5. Locate the Email section under the “Account Information” tab and click the Edit button next to your current email address.

Verifying Identity for Email Modification

1. Binance initiates a real-time identity verification step before allowing email changes.

2. You may be prompted to re-enter your login password or confirm via Google Authenticator or SMS-based 2FA.

3. Some accounts require additional verification if flagged for high-risk activity or recent login anomalies.

4. If you have completed KYC Level 2, the system may cross-check your verified ID document against the registered name and email domain.

5. Failure to complete this verification halts the process immediately—no temporary or partial updates are permitted.

Entering and Confirming the New Email Address

1. Type the new email address carefully in the designated input field—no spaces or special characters except the standard @ and dot notation.

2. Binance validates domain authenticity in real time; disposable domains like mailinator.com or 10minutemail.net are rejected outright.

3. A six-digit verification code is sent exclusively to the new email address—not the old one.

4. You must access that inbox within 30 minutes to retrieve and enter the code into the Binance interface.

5. Entering an incorrect or expired code triggers a 15-minute cooldown before another attempt is allowed.

Finalizing the Change and System Confirmation

1. After successful code entry, Binance displays a green success banner confirming the update.

2. The system automatically logs you out from all active sessions across devices and browsers.

3. A confirmation email is dispatched to both the old and new addresses detailing the timestamp, IP address, and geolocation of the change request.

4. Your API keys remain unaffected unless you manually revoke them—but trading permissions tied to email-bound whitelists must be reconfigured.

5. Any pending withdrawal requests linked to the previous email will not auto-forward—the user must reinitiate them post-update.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I change my Binance email without access to the old email inbox?A: No. Binance does not offer email recovery bypasses. You must access the original inbox to approve the change or contact support with documented proof of ownership.

Q: Does changing my email affect my Binance wallet addresses or deposit history?A: No. Wallet addresses, transaction records, and blockchain balances remain fully intact and unchanged.

Q: Why does Binance block email changes after multiple failed attempts?A: This is an anti-account-takeover measure. Repeated failures trigger a 72-hour lockout to prevent brute-force exploitation of the verification flow.

Q: Is it possible to use a corporate or alias email domain for Binance registration?A: Yes, provided the domain allows inbound SMTP delivery and is not listed on Binance’s restricted domain registry—common exclusions include shared enterprise mail gateways with forwarding rules disabled.
